In Miami Gardens, Florida, when it comes to the distribution and administration of a deceased individual's assets, a demand to produce a copy of the will may arise. This legal document plays a pivotal role in verifying the decedent's wishes and ensuring the smooth transfer of property and assets to the rightful beneficiaries. If you find yourself in the position of an heir, executor, or person in possession of the will, it is crucial to understand the different types of demands to produce a copy of the will that may be encountered. 1. General Demand to Produce Copy of Will: A general demand to produce a copy of the will in Miami Gardens, Florida, is typically made by an interested party seeking information regarding the last testament of the deceased. This demand allows the party making the request to review the contents of the will for their own records or legal proceedings. 2. Demand to Produce Copy of Will for Probate Purposes: In certain situations, the court may demand the executor or person in possession of the will to produce a copy specifically for probate purposes. This demand ensures that the will is reviewed, validated, and used as the guiding document during the distribution of the deceased's estate. 3. Demand to Produce Copy of Will for Dispute Resolution: When conflicts or disputes arise among potential beneficiaries or interested parties regarding the validity or interpretation of the will, a demand may be made to produce a copy of the will. This type of demand aims to resolve the disputes by examining the contents and intent of the deceased as outlined in the will. 4. Demand to Produce Copy of Will for Trust Administration: In cases where the deceased had established a trust as part of their estate plan, a demand may be made to produce a copy of the will for trust administration purposes. This demand ensures that the provisions of the trust are correctly implemented, and assets are distributed according to the decedent's wishes.
